Why Family Involvement Matters in AA Meetings


Alcohol addiction can tear families apart, but it can also be the very reason people fight harder to get sober. When loved ones attend AA meetings, they show their commitment to walking the recovery path together. The meetings give them a front-row seat to the emotional work involved, helping them gain empathy and insight.


Family involvement also promotes accountability. Knowing that someone you love is watching your progress can be a powerful motivator. In turn, family members learn how to be supportive without being enabling.
